Ingredients

  • 6 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il, plus more for racks of lamb, if using
  • ¼ cup fresh lemon juice
  • lemon wedges for serving
  • couscous with almonds and raisins, for serving
  • 2 teaspoons freshly ground black pepper
  • 2 teaspoons sweet paprika
  • 2 teaspoons ground cumin
  • 1 ½ teaspoons ground coriander
  • ½ teaspoon cayenne pepper
  • harissa for serving
  • one 4- to 5-pound boned lamb shoulder, or 3 racks of lamb, ends trimmed, or one 6-pound boneless leg of lamb
  • 2 tablespoons minced garlic, plus 3 cloves garlic, cut into slivers
  • ½ cup chopped fresh coriander (cilantro)
